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8090966 54057548465 016048846 626139 14113
50142 5278 64286984
50142 5278 64286984
906 508572 914432
All about undefined
Interested in learning more?
50142 5278 64286984
906 508572 914432
See more
81677683800 056322 786451778
8486 078529 76429 2450180 460
See more
488127525 36097465969 360878939
7111812 77074622388 31607060
See more